TEAM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

440 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Atlassian (TEAM)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$15.8B — up 19% from $13.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 108 funds opened new TEAM positions and 61 closed out — a net gain of 47 holders — while 158 added to existing stakes and 119 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Jennison Associates, opening a new position worth an estimated $357M. The largest seller was Lone Pine Capital, cutting an estimated $197M.
